ABOUT US

Almost million residents call York Region home, making it one of the largest regions in Canada – and the fastest growing with a population that’s expected to grow to more than 2 million by 2041. Our geography, which is comprised of about 1,800 square kilometers over nine different municipalities, is as beautiful, interesting and diverse as our people. Local government is organized in a two-tier structure and we work together with our local municipalities to provide residents and businesses access to a broad selection of services and resources.

ABOUT THE ROLE Reporting to the Deputy Regional Clerk, is responsible for providing administrative support to Committees and Council including attendance at in-camera meetings and public hearings.

W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ING

  • Attends and records proceedings of regular, in-camera and public meetings of assigned Committee.
  • Attends and records proceedings of Regional Council under the direction of the Regional Clerk as required.
  • Coordinates and is responsible for meeting location, deputants, and forms and ensures availability of agenda materials for public and media.
  • Provides guidance to deputants appearing before Committees and/or Council, including completing Deputation Form.
  • Liaises with Commissioner and Chair of Committee regarding agenda items, preparation, and meeting arrangements.
  • Provides assistance to Committee Chair and Commissioner before, during and after meetings, which may include procedural advice.
  • Coordinates confidential and sensitive in-camera documents related to labour relations, solicitor-client privilege, personnel and sensitive political issues and ensures document security.
  • Provides direction, support and assistance to the Clerk’s Office doing the preparation of Notices, Agendas (using Agenda Management System software), and Reports for assigned Committees.
  • Assists in the development, administration, and maintenance of the agenda management system, website or other computer systems.
  • Researches, coordinates, and prepares documentation regarding special projects ( Committee Coordinators Manual, Agenda Preparation Checklist, revision of Deputation Form Indexing, Inaugural, appointments to various committees, Council and Committee attendance, etc).
  • Ensures data bases for e-mail distribution lists are correct and updated regularly.
  • Researches, prepares, and responds to correspondence and inquiries from external sources and internal customers at all levels of the Corporation.
  • Researches and prepares correspondence in connection with Council and Committee Reports for the Regional Clerk and Deputy Regional Clerk, within strict deadlines.
  • Prepares Notices, Agendas, Reports, Minutes, internal and external communications for assigned Committees, with assistance from Council Committee Assistants, and within strict timelines, on a regular basis.
